What is it about?

Transformational leadership is a contemporary approach to leadership which emphasizes the role of the leader in developing and motivating followers. We study its impact on educational outcomes as perceived by teachers. The findings point to links between transformational leadership, perceived school effectiveness and job satisfaction.

Why is it important?

The findings have implications for educational policy and specifically for the adoption of specific leadership approaches and practices at the school level.

Perspectives

The findings show that the context matters in educational leadership. This study was conducted in a small country with a centralized educational system. This is reflected in the findings.
